Аннотация:A highly transparent ceramics based on erbium oxide was successfully obtained using a sintering additive of
lanthanum oxide. The microstructure and phase composition of the initial powders and the obtained ceramics, as
well as the sinterability of the powder compacts depending on the content of the sintering additive, were studied.
5% La:Er2O3 ceramics showed the best combination of characteristics among the studied samples. In particular, it
has 81.3% linear transmission at a wavelength of 1.8 μm for 1 mm thickness, a microhardness of 8.6 GPa, an
elastic modulus of 190 GPa, a crack resistance of 0.98 MPa m0.5, and a thermal conductivity of 6 W/m⋅K at 298 K.
